Why Home Workouts Are Perfect for Nigerians

Home workouts offer numerous advantages that are particularly appealing to Nigerians. First and foremost, they save time. With the traffic congestion in major cities, commuting to a gym can be time-consuming. By working out at home, you eliminate the need for travel and can fit exercise into your schedule more easily.

Cost-Effective Fitness

Gym memberships can be expensive, especially in upscale areas. Home workouts, on the other hand, require minimal investment. With just a few essential pieces of equipment or even none at all, you can achieve a full-body workout. Items like resistance bands, dumbbells, or a yoga mat are affordable and versatile.

Flexibility and Privacy

Home workouts allow you to exercise whenever you like, making it easier to incorporate fitness into your daily routine. Additionally, you can enjoy the privacy of your own home, away from the sometimes intimidating atmosphere of a gym.

Essential Home Workout Equipment

While it's possible to perform effective workouts without any equipment, having a few basic items can enhance your routine significantly.

Resistance Bands

  • Portable and versatile
  • Great for strength training
  • Ideal for targeting different muscle groups

Resistance bands are a must-have for any home gym. They are lightweight, affordable, and can be used to perform a wide range of exercises. Whether you're focusing on arms, legs, or core, resistance bands offer adjustable resistance levels to suit your fitness level.

Dumbbells

  • Available in various weights
  • Perfect for building muscle mass
  • Can be used for numerous exercises

Dumbbells are excellent for those who wish to add some weight to their exercises. Start with lighter weights and gradually increase as you build strength.

Yoga Mat

  • Cushions your body during workouts
  • Provides a non-slip surface
  • Essential for floor exercises and stretches

A yoga mat is essential for performing floor exercises comfortably. It provides cushioning for your joints and ensures a stable surface for various workouts.

Effective Home Workout Routines

Home workouts can be just as effective as gym workouts if done correctly. Here are some routines you can try based on your fitness goals.

Full-Body Workout

  1. Warm-up: Jumping jacks - 3 minutes
  2. Push-ups - 3 sets of 10-15 reps
  3. Squats - 3 sets of 15 reps
  4. Plank hold - 3 sets of 30 seconds
  5. Cool down: Stretching - 5 minutes

This routine targets all major muscle groups and can be performed with body weight alone. It helps improve strength, endurance, and flexibility.

Cardio Blast

  1. High knees - 3 sets of 30 seconds
  2. Burpees - 3 sets of 10 reps
  3. Mountain climbers - 3 sets of 30 seconds
  4. Jump rope - 3 sets of 1 minute
  5. Cool down: Walking and stretching - 5 minutes

Cardio workouts are great for burning calories and improving cardiovascular health. These exercises can be performed in a small space, making them ideal for home workouts.

Strength and Tone

  • Resistance band bicep curls - 3 sets of 12 reps
  • Tricep dips on a chair - 3 sets of 12 reps
  • Lunges with dumbbells - 3 sets of 12 reps per leg
  • Russian twists - 3 sets of 15 reps
  • Cool down: Yoga stretches - 5 minutes

For those looking to build muscle and tone their body, this routine incorporates equipment for added resistance and effectiveness.
